PROBLEM TO BE SOLVED: To provide a method for manufacturing a liquid crystal display that can deter an alignment defect due to a step on a substrate surface from being generated. SOLUTION: The entire surface of an array substrate 10 where a TFT 95 is formed is coated with a flattening film 18 functioning as a 2nd inter-layer insulating film (Fig.(b)). Then the flattening film 18 is exposed (exposure quantity: 200 mJ/cm2) to irradiating light (i line) through a photomask 41 having an opening pattern 41a arranged (Fig.(c)). Further, the flattening film 18 is exposed (exposure quantity: 50 mJ/cm2) to irradiating light through a photomask 42 having an opening pattern 42a arranged (Fig.(d)). Then spray development is carried to remove (etch) exposed areas, and bleach exposure is carried out by a contact exposing machine. Consequently, a 2nd contact hole 20 penetrating the flattening film 18 is formed and a recessed part 80 is formed in the flattening film 18 on the area where the TFT 95 is formed (Fig.(e)).
